schtruck wrote:@deejayzee on which game you have such stuttering with SPUSYNC to on? and are you using frameskipping?

I tried 'Tekken 3' and 'Revelations - Persona', both have sound stuttering with frameskip on and off . With SPU sync set to off sound isn't stutter, but in 'Revelations-Persona' seems to lack some sounds and effects. Music sounds different than original.
I tested a bit OpenGL mode and it works much better - again in 'Persona' game, 2D scenes doesn't slow down when using frameskip.
Software mode is now feels smooth as never before, but it is true when you use only one option - framelimiter OR frameskip, or switch them off completely. But when both options is ON every game stutters, it feels like fpse skips too much frames. Maybe an option to choose frameskip level will do something with this? I mean if I can choose to skip 1 or 2 frames, not only 10, 20 - 50 fps.

Postby schtruck » Wed Sep 05, 2012 6:44 am

i'm not sure your saves will be lost, try to take a look to /sdcard/.fpse

i made something to avoid losting savestates and memcards by copying them immediatly to this directory

it can be something else then /sdcard but usually it's where it's placed. DOn't forget to activate show hidden files in your file browser.

About the crash of OpenGL in your tablet, i need a log using the free software logcat. can you do it and send me to my email please?
